Finley Potter (born 14 March 2004) is an English professional footballer who plays as a defender for EFL League Two club Fleetwood Town.
Potter came through the academy of Sheffield United, being rewarded with a scholarship deal in August 2020.[3] His deal started in unfortunate circumstances, missing eighteen months through injury before his return to action in February 2022.[4]
In February 2023, he joined National League club Barnet on loan for the remainder of the season.[5] Following a successful spell, he returned for a season-long loan ahead of the 2023–24 season,[6] being recalled in February 2024.[7]
On 1 February 2024, Potter joined League One club Fleetwood Town on an eighteen-month contract with the option for a further year.[8][9] He made his debut on the final day of the season, as already relegated Fleetwood won 3–0 against Burton Albion.[10]
On 7 May 2025, the club announced it had activated a one-year extension for the player.[11]
